From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id C920AA04A6; Wed, 9 Feb 2022 11:23:51 +0100 (CET) Received: from [217.70.189.124] (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id B83FB41141; Wed, 9 Feb 2022 11:23:51 +0100 (CET) Received: from mga03.intel.com (mga03.intel.com [134.134.136.65]) by mails.dpdk.org (Postfix) with ESMTP id 8C83641101 for ; Wed, 9 Feb 2022 11:23:49 +0100 (CET)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=intel.com; i=@intel.com; q=dns/txt; s=Intel; t=1644402229; x=1675938229; h=from:to:cc:subject:date:message-id:references: in-reply-to:content-transfer-encoding:mime-version; bh=hHZdRvrQwy/3uYxmuW8EVuCGlevInwft82GrdnmSUr0=; b=ZlcR0Nzyg2YmJXLC2XDC1ujBXAeGbVAZLTgKy993jdX26pI+vzfXRlQg qelscFsXERzt2pGFt6ZZKWr1p5pLG743kHHZrip/eTdsASWtoIbeWcMJv sdBWy1w3qxEVnB+NbTs/Y7wqb8ekTF+jS5Rgex5fj+twesc0Y0XU0pBVB gfuuPyKuTs/ZS7r+GPUmNa7bC/1kAQzv1ti0gGN+9G5AoEr8KQIzYNzHm vtixrIH/IL039YVLk9hCnuYobiq2ylaNH7E1/MHQvQyD31kSxu+zDqeAv om1fsMR3dkZ/aJcSeODXAxVXgBYgxoeQH7KHroqGpwsmi1zUKRAAb5JTu A==; X-IronPort-AV: E=McAfee;i="6200,9189,10252"; a="249120577" X-IronPort-AV: E=Sophos;i="5.88,355,1635231600"; d="scan'208";a="249120577" Received: from orsmga008.jf.intel.com ([10.7.209.65]) by orsmga103.jf.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 09 Feb 2022 02:23:29 -0800 X-ExtLoop1: 1 X-IronPort-AV: E=Sophos;i="5.88,355,1635231600"; d="scan'208";a="541034340" Received: from orsmsx604.amr.corp.intel.com ([10.22.229.17]) by orsmga008.jf.intel.com with ESMTP; 09 Feb 2022 02:23:29 -0800 Received: from orsmsx608.amr.corp.intel.com (10.22.229.21) by ORSMSX604.amr.corp.intel.com (10.22.229.17)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2308.20; Wed, 9 Feb 2022 02:23:29 -0800 Received: from orsmsx606.amr.corp.intel.com (10.22.229.19) by ORSMSX608.amr.corp.intel.com (10.22.229.21)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2308.20; Wed, 9 Feb 2022 02:23:29 -0800 Received: from ORSEDG602.ED.cps.intel.com (10.7.248.7) by orsmsx606.amr.corp.intel.com (10.22.229.19)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2308.20 via Frontend Transport; Wed, 9 Feb 2022 02:23:29 -0800 Received: from NAM04-DM6-obe.outbound.protection.outlook.com (104.47.73.41) by edgegateway.intel.com (134.134.137.103)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.1.2308.20; Wed, 9 Feb 2022 02:23:28 -0800 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=dxD8/FQ1NAq8LgcOxug4zT9jU/zNBHZii/ezsyC4VXlLcOw3JTkf47TcokC8ygfK54aL6QKGLLBs40rR3506wfgdindFGK/cXSkLtGrFBr56ot6BW1QaGmq2ueyUm7YYPfyyq2GPeJH+uSbc39J0cRA14C9e9IY+PPH1J/3t06PYUXA2u4aVDk0jgYi3l+oR36HxVmZJ6CkrNOeboENiLJnMJsSll9C0djZreAcUjkK19GZQFavQlV6Do3x01JHhyNYqR4+QfoXwqmvwhYXANNMHCiBW4enuDj2A+VGMAo29VNoPXKPBQuUhrAdAeC/UQFyUr2CMUzF9G6YEWe4kgA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=hHZdRvrQwy/3uYxmuW8EVuCGlevInwft82GrdnmSUr0=; b=TuQYHNwZdsSEtcMZTuL2lFSd/eQ6yA4Lj3D8Qw21d6NO+ke9xZgrUvLArcUJyV5cQMVr1R72IaakP5alyYwM969nquVKnlIeLxtuUQFeG2r6R7TC+2/dHx9SD+7YLRr+IlsoSoRmftNcTJsTs+cz8l6v1owwyaJL9pRaVaqiAdcI0mf8WSMPCbs/avvF5VKoccq+Rfelaf+V7flIuNdxBbWab6dKvYCTdyYn/OGUSns2dBTy5hvbS6cv/j7QWwrDpvnVcJDl+RubIekYvDzAN1h4BZOi7Goaluv0AYj9ufEOxAQUMZ2eSTKSC50TxGGRjoYmHXUsMi25wcq5Qu0B9Q==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=none; dmarc=none; dkim=none; arc=none Received: from MW5PR11MB5809.namprd11.prod.outlook.com (2603:10b6:303:197::6) by DM5PR11MB1674.namprd11.prod.outlook.com (2603:10b6:4:b::8)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.4951.17; Wed, 9 Feb 2022 10:23:27 +0000 Received: from MW5PR11MB5809.namprd11.prod.outlook.com ([fe80::a599:b969:5072:71cb]) by MW5PR11MB5809.namprd11.prod.outlook.com ([fe80::a599:b969:5072:71cb%4]) with mapi id 15.20.4951.019; Wed, 9 Feb 2022 10:23:27 +0000 From: "Zhang, Roy Fan" To: "Ji, Kai" , "dev@dpdk.org" CC: "gakhil@marvell.com" , "Ji, Kai" Subject: RE: [dpdk-dev v7 04/10] crypto/qat: rework session APIs Thread-Topic: [dpdk-dev v7 04/10] crypto/qat: rework session APIs Thread-Index: AQHYHRflhCmo6bkj9ECOA/7qga91mKyLA+XA Date: Wed, 9 Feb 2022 10:23:27 +0000 Message-ID: References: <20220204185057.29893-11-kai.ji@intel.com> <20220208181454.69121-1-kai.ji@intel.com> <20220208181454.69121-5-kai.ji@intel.com> In-Reply-To: <20220208181454.69121-5-kai.ji@intel.com> Accept-Language: zh-Hans-HK, en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: dlp-version: 11.6.200.16 dlp-reaction: no-action dlp-product: dlpe-windows authentication-results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=intel.com; x-ms-publictraffictype: Email x-ms-office365-filtering-correlation-id: a404cc54-87fb-4867-d81a-08d9ebb6362a x-ms-traffictypediagnostic: DM5PR11MB1674:EE_ x-microsoft-antispam-prvs: x-ms-oob-tlc-oobclassifiers: OLM:5236; x-ms-exchange-senderadcheck: 1 x-ms-exchange-antispam-relay: 0 x-microsoft-antispam: BCL:0; x-microsoft-antispam-message-info: qYgrKqnDoEd35h9StzrFyJF5+T91e9l1P9WWAx2Fo7Ud/BrdgcrVl5Pxk9li00fmlTfCif7BCOi6u9FzY+Op45yMRJNkeSv88qq1z0N1C8ruYJeRpD7547T4CT2hF5MzPhd9AUoExBDXkqB9g+GwS+Dver9yZ4Z2ob/FiGYpVknNZA2HgpJDEFq0zUqokbIKLA5T+BWZ5bJB33mmEsPYU+PzCtex56O/npjk+xTFaE/Zqlt7R3lIw96vE/zz0AuwCu7wHHTTU0ZN7yi8de7XO7B6L0Jb0K1JTxFY4Q4O2sNzph6HcuVOT6L/kVqNh9M+eXWJJjQm3EU9v5pBsPGefkUJ7lPL5H6TI/UbJAR6dxvJNcFqnNVQU+G6E/2tis+ROC3r7ELAuSgsCzarCwi0VccgBsHrvn9mqrY9GT7yRRCp0393mZ7DSsuMV8ijoRRfA+ZrS263i7MP3KbEfdTOKj6p+u7TqRAaRfX3leMM5WYudgE1i0RztdFgqc6NENFc/p8D6F5CAZlXm1NhttLp5R/tcowzy1zrEmT2MHBpfMXXXbmiDaJMiYaBaEC9sjk2KEeE+dqnnjMDqEramPi2Ix87qgb5db2k8Gt/7oodE1W9V2KyuRFdpZgh6p+WJgb6Ko4uezyuoMvvWullpHRcAqYKOiSKML+v06MjHRW+2/3Ga0+ivJeDZ8E9kxItGI7aJ8TZueHSsM9CvOLfQ82Vjg== x-forefront-antispam-report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:MW5PR11MB5809.namprd11.prod.outlook.com; PTR:; CAT:NONE; SFS:(13230001)(366004)(55016003)(5660300002)(54906003)(9686003)(6506007)(4744005)(53546011)(66946007)(86362001)(76116006)(122000001)(83380400001)(7696005)(316002)(110136005)(508600001)(66556008)(52536014)(8936002)(38100700002)(4326008)(107886003)(71200400001)(2906002)(8676002)(64756008)(33656002)(26005)(186003)(82960400001)(66476007)(38070700005)(66446008); DIR:OUT; SFP:1102; x-ms-exchange-antispam-messagedata-chunkcount: 1 x-ms-exchange-antispam-messagedata-0: =?Windows-1252?Q?NbLv7dDvmziVM1nU1kllK8QUDM1bQ8HHUvGV0rqbdp7HYrxsIRKSXW3k?= =?Windows-1252?Q?AJBIzwd3PUlPx7a139TB+cs/OyxjG/K2J9OrRC1e/UJaojh3YTjqMMil?= =?Windows-1252?Q?8yS5q37tGQleaCY3cW3hoPPhlPeMgCk//G/iYzn15holdlYfGbylQ5vg?= =?Windows-1252?Q?28KCKnXLpLxgrXHIPgfi9dPUd4HJKLvSXYDSNEZaZRJwa/h3HWj5UE61?= =?Windows-1252?Q?NMYFYzRuNMRBHTElIafAKCRSD5xIXJrtLtZ9yz05gHjKwq+VpH9E95IQ?= =?Windows-1252?Q?0E6iQ1CAtaBj0DtCMnB0BAgxJVlnXmksW3FgKsSjR+Dqsvhg4wZhpULn?= =?Windows-1252?Q?TpfADxCL1WwkZQvtiOfjJp5aZrt/gRvuMgstZ1LfQ6rImdHQOvRzo3q0?= =?Windows-1252?Q?5JBoouEJdBUE1xyw6KpfihBuT9w7JmCeeOnhpxZBars7pjEkIS3HFWKZ?= =?Windows-1252?Q?VkFc2M0rPVb2BcA6YaIWY0UgmEyQy3EVga+BWWvT1IPqwJEp7x/0mar8?= =?Windows-1252?Q?uzIkwEfR+s0FkekZMc7Tvi5U+M/o0NqWcQRLBxVUeYI50o7Fk3Z+hbF0?= =?Windows-1252?Q?eBVt180Mn256ygVVnxdubQVgYtkd2AxI2esGaauEXUWaKiOGLBemErfD?= =?Windows-1252?Q?vqc3w1IuFlg4fNtPMZUMNxkqeZdimLvhy2dCAP6+8yl8u7IdFltIk5fz?= =?Windows-1252?Q?czAKGby7Xg983Uh1YILEtCKYZAYYR+kDk2HbDPawWKf5kaWSyrq+mxkk?= =?Windows-1252?Q?zMVsSw5IYcKf0RoUZalZJJ5+Z7YuAvvVGL27MEr02c7Gv4qdgZvUvFIn?= =?Windows-1252?Q?gJpAcEU3J9yzQwgyZv+xbnGMRvmHeqRCUQkV16k9atEzF1/hA/isnpw8?= =?Windows-1252?Q?x9yCgXMu3fOyrVtp6YT5fsLHCUhr7MpM9UnmXcB7VXnMQ81kqufXOiiU?= =?Windows-1252?Q?ShpMaMTvU16AOQem9nxHFx3K4sy73zXwZgNaEBEA94b17yO0yyl730y7?= =?Windows-1252?Q?m8cN5XPa+yjbStVNOhWRUbcz8ivFbyRQ/FTtNWIE6iX7jXTr6J/cFsoL?= =?Windows-1252?Q?6jVSFt/wlPi6eGMDQWRgdN3/8morjNdxrJBMVmWq2iaR2qz1OclZZnap?= =?Windows-1252?Q?AAQ2KgLMRCPfY9Agx5p9wWVRT6Z8/8LNSo5NcpH4SqEjtbAGwKtRwpcz?= =?Windows-1252?Q?AHpYyjzR7IsKcUYhKQpOgBGXsmeIKWPQ5MrHjOD1xY2gjHu4QvmTIoOm?= =?Windows-1252?Q?NohusAsIVdnvk2ozG4stomHvSUFA41amxhViO+hOLuREdIkEZ7SwoO2+?= =?Windows-1252?Q?Qs9nZR/elUktkzObVXEN8vbYAxQ7vGZNjwGUhxs9Pa8QtvBt0F01dHT+?= =?Windows-1252?Q?wSkt8sQSBELTbTVnkicsyBW1io+IncNIG4quUjVg4xr7R5aAqapFikhJ?= =?Windows-1252?Q?p3ClmxxPQPiszhlwS/Z6B1Wl3RJm48WVVc28al0g+OxuFwNAF10n1vyv?= =?Windows-1252?Q?T9AdquYGcpJhyma5LK2p3KJPIl8XgMgZxATIjx/x2pDHZbHE8KCtRMmr?= =?Windows-1252?Q?oOzYfHOzl/Ed3h3FNDjgAyCf2WlfLTd/BBthBqwfYSAKy06ld+GpKcQo?= =?Windows-1252?Q?gK+9rfIP6W8sz0Zq7SSA9zL0h2lGP2H+Mdz5zUz22x910SUu1fxaUKpf?= =?Windows-1252?Q?t++cMp/HZsFnlkZi6xd+Xay0StrUkXuJ7llx3F2eXTfNl3m3A+reSbX2?= =?Windows-1252?Q?bIFijkRZyZHq2qFUHjI=3D?= Content-Type: text/plain; charset="Windows-1252" Content-Transfer-Encoding: quoted-printable MIME-Version: 1.0 X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-AuthSource: MW5PR11MB5809.namprd11.prod.outlook.com X-MS-Exchange-CrossTenant-Network-Message-Id: a404cc54-87fb-4867-d81a-08d9ebb6362a X-MS-Exchange-CrossTenant-originalarrivaltime: 09 Feb 2022 10:23:27.4363 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Hosted X-MS-Exchange-CrossTenant-id: 46c98d88-e344-4ed4-8496-4ed7712e255d X-MS-Exchange-CrossTenant-mailboxtype: HOSTED X-MS-Exchange-CrossTenant-userprincipalname: uPBUWuZsv2rt3L79+zSgSFum2v1IwP8BiGLSiVloiW2A0fotVQPSP/tOojbBHZ4bttlbNGV8N/oWm0zId/oEOA== X-MS-Exchange-Transport-CrossTenantHeadersStamped: DM5PR11MB1674 X-OriginatorOrg: intel.com X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org > -----Original Message----- > From: Kai Ji > Sent: Tuesday, February 8, 2022 6:15 PM > To: dev@dpdk.org > Cc: gakhil@marvell.com; Ji, Kai > Subject: [dpdk-dev v7 04/10] crypto/qat: rework session APIs >=20 > This patch introduces the set_session methods for different > generations of QAT. In addition, the patch replaces > 'min_qat_dev_gen_id' with 'qat_dev_gen'. Thus, the session > no longer allow to be created by one generation of QAT used by another > generation. >=20 > Signed-off-by: Kai Ji > --- Acked-by: Fan Zhang